I had one of the expeditions when I was trying out scopes for my 17hmr. I used it for a couple of days and it was a really nice scope. It was a larger varmint type scope around 20 power or so with the adjustable objective. It went for around 200 some dollars at Cabela's. I had to spend another $200 to get a scope that I thought was better.

The only reason I didn't keep it is I wanted slighty better optics at 100 yards, not that the ones on the simmons were bad. It blew away any BSA or simular type scope I have used in the past and was better than the simmons 44 mag series my buddy has, at twice the power! All the adjustment rings turned nice and smooth like a quality camera lens and looked built very well. I thought it was better than the leupold I looked at for over 400 bucks in over all function and looks. The leupold did have better glass I thought, that was just comparing them in the store though.

For 60 bucks I would snag one up in a heart beat, and I'm broke. I would love to have one for that price to put on my ML.
